Sorry Mazda 95 318SLT is right! 91-96 hoods are same. Different from 87-90 And 91 came with the LA318 Throttle body Injection. (Not Magnum, and not Multi-port FI).
In 92 Magnum engines came out.

Go to here for 90 body parts. Hoods and grills are the same for 87-90.

http://ecat.crosscanadaparts.com/php...&engine=0&view=

Go to here for 91 body parts. Hoods and grills are the same for 91-96.

http://ecat.crosscanadaparts.com/php...&engine=0&view=

Fenders fit all years.

As for the 91 318, yes it did happen. You can check the parts manual we have in the FAQ, I just checked it is there.
